KHQ Local News talked to our Founder about the importance of the new Ranger’s Law.

“Dan Regester, the executive director of K-9 Kavalry, first brought forward the bill. Regester, a retired veteran, shared that his service dog, Ranger, plays a crucial role in his daily life. However, he faces challenges with parking access for safely loading and unloading his dog.”

Wow can’t believe it was a week ago today that Dan & Ranger threw out the first pitch at the Portland Pickles Baseball game!

The ceremonial first pitch is a longstanding ritual of baseball in which a guest of honor throws a ball to mark the end of pregame festivities and the start of the game. Since 1910 all but two US presidents have thrown out ceremonial first pitches at one of of the three important baseball games annually (Opening Day, the All Star Game or the World Series).

The Portland Pickles chose to bestow this honor on the 4th of July to the director and founder of K9K in honor of the partnership between the two organizations. To throw out a ceremonial first pitch at America’s Pastime on America’s birthday could have only been more representative of America if Dan was eating a slice of apple pie while doing it!

Another great opportunity to bring the vision of K9K to the veterans of Oregon!

At the 80th Oregon Department of Veterans' Affairs Expo in Salem, dozens of veterans organizations from across Oregon came together to offer benefits and services to Oregon veterans. There were roughly 300+ veterans at the Expo, with dozens of veterans specifically asking about K9K and our benefits for veterans.

Everyone loved seeing the puppers. There was high interest in our program because we help train veterans to train their service dogs to meet their disability needs, and the service dogs get to learn and grow with them. Our goal is to help veterans gain a resource for a better life experience with training, life skills management, and having a service dog, as well as the benefits of having a battle buddy by their side and camaraderie with veterans in our pack.
